Analysis

Norway recorded 28.42 for total ghg emissions by sector (mt co2 eq) - total including lucf in 2018.

The figure is up 1.6% on the previous year and up 12.4% over ten years.

Over the whole period, total ghg emissions by sector (mt co2 eq) - total including lucf in Norway peaked at 37.58 in 1999 and was at its lowest, 24.51, in 2002.

Norway ranks 111th of 189 countries on this measure, in the middle of the range.

The long-run direction has been consistently falling across the 29 years of available data.

Total greenhouse gas emissions (including LUCF) are generated from the World Resource Institute's Climate Watch. Climate Watch Historical Emission data contains sector-level greenhouse gas (GHG) emissions data for 194 countries and the European Union (EU) for the period 1990-2018, including emissions of the six major GHGs from most major sources and sinks. Non-CO2 emissions are expressed in CO2 equivalents using 100-year global warming potential values from IPCC Fourth Assessment Report. Climate Watch Historical GHG Emissions data (previously published through CAIT Climate Data Explorer) are derived from several sources. Any use of the Land-Use Change and Forestry or Agriculture indicator should be cited as FAO 2020, FAOSTAT Emissions Database. Any use of CO2 emissions from fuel combustion data should be cited as CO2 Emissions from Fuel Combustion, OECD/IEA, 2020.
